Transaction 1bd84878afc03d68754d64c800cb996c61c31d6acf67fdead5822a43fb885588
1 Input
1 Output
-
1bd84878afc03d68754d64c800cb996c61c31d6acf67fdead5822a43fb885588:0
- value
- 154346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5044a67ea26cb17313c37a32a4a275dbd4ed376d OP_EQUAL
- address
- 391SDoSWQUreUy8wUhAe26smYmfTuU3vn9